Image:Cincinnati-fountain-square-full.jpg A fountain square is a park or plaza in a city that features a fountain. A fountain square is similar to a town square but is usually smaller and not situated in front of the town hall or county courthouse. It may stand alone or as part of a larger public park.
In the United States, there are numerous fountain squares, many of which are actually called "Fountain Square," including those in Cincinnati, Ohio, Indianapolis, Indiana, Evanston, Illinois, Bloomington, Indiana, Bowling Green, Kentucky.
Fountain Square in Baku, Azerbaijan is one of the country's most famous tourist destinations.
